   The very first sentence in the book &#8216;This is not a traditional quilt book&#8217; tells you that you are in for a treat!  So many quilting instruction books are published these days and after a while they all run together.  </p>
<p>   Every day my customers come in and say &#8216;I can&#8217;t buy anything else until I finish the projects I&#8217;ve started&#8217;.  Well, no I have just the book to offer them to help with that objective.</p>
<p>    Many subjects are covered in this book &#8211; finishing existing blocks, setting the blocks with or without sashings, setting those blocks in a straight manner or on point, with or without borders.  Marguerita is also honest by telling you that not all blocks and or quilts will work with the &#8216;finish as you go&#8217; method.</p>
<p>    Finish (almost) Any Quilt is self-published.  This allowed Marguerita to include far more color pictures and illustrations than you will ever find in a book released by one of the major publishers.  Marguerita also shot videos as she created the projects for the book.  She is releasing those videos as an added bonus on her Crazy Shortcut  Quilts Youtube Channel (be sure you subscribe so you don&#8217;t miss a one of them).</p>
<p>    There is no way you can go wrong with this book if you are working your way through your stash.  I have added it to my quilt book library and I&#8217;m recommending it to my students and customers.</p>

We are all looking for timesavers so we have more time to actually quilt.</p>
<p>A die-cutter and a few dies will really help you &#8216;bust your stash&#8217;.  Once you get in the habit of cutting those leftover pieces into useable strips and squares, you&#8217;ll find that making a scrap quilt is a breeze.</p>
<p>You can&nbsp;<A href="http://webstore.quiltropolis.net/stores_app/Browse_Dept_Items.asp?Store_id=748&#038;page_id=17&#038;categ_id=198" target=_blank>click here</A> to see all of the Sizzix Quilting Die Cutters and dies that we are offering.  Some of them will need to be special ordered but there&#8217;s still time.  Just let us know by December 11th what to put in your shopping bag and we&#8217;ll get it ordered.</p>
<p>One thing to note, Sizzix dies <strong>will not </strong> work in the Accuquilt Go! cutter but the Accuquilt Go! dies <strong> will </strong> work in the Big Shot.  Accuquilt Studio dies, as well as Go! dies work in the Big Shot Pro. <br /></br><br />
